Re: Octavia E. Butler against Lovecraft (World Fantasy Award).

Wasn't there a Wells book where he wipes out all Muslims worldwide in order to establish Utopia? If I remember right it included airplane (then super science fiction tech) raids on Mecca.

It's interesting to note what the present does and doesn't let the past get away with. Most people wouldn't think of rich Harvard graduates who got away with irresponsible murder because their parents kept bailing them out as their idea of counter cultural heroes, but William S Burroughs. M.P. Shiel probably isn't well-known enough for the child molester revelations to generate much interest. I remember Arthur Koestler - at present pretty obscure but once well-known - got dug back up for a while because it came out that he was a serial rapist. 

It's nothing new, Catullus and other classical writers were banned through much of the 19th century, and Shakespeare got Bowdlerized. I wonder if there's a statute of limitations...haven't heard many recent attacks on Ovid despite him recommending rape...

Current society isn't much different from the Victorians...ask anyone who has failed a job interview because of the wrong pictures of them coming up on Google...in some respects it is worse than the 19th century.
